The Importance Of IT Support For Healthcare

  • by

In today’s digital age, technology plays a vital role in all industries, including healthcare With the advancement of technology, healthcare organizations are relying more and more on IT support to improve patient care, streamline processes, and ensure data security IT support for healthcare is essential in order for healthcare providers to deliver efficient and effective services to their patients.

The healthcare industry has become increasingly reliant on technology to manage patient records, communication between healthcare professionals, billing and scheduling, and many other essential tasks As a result, IT support has become a critical component of healthcare operations Here are some of the key reasons why IT support is so important for healthcare:

1 Improved Patient Care: IT support helps healthcare providers to access patient records quickly and securely This means that healthcare professionals can make more informed decisions about patient care, leading to better outcomes for patients With the help of IT support, healthcare providers can also communicate more effectively with other members of the care team, ensuring that patients receive the best possible treatment.

2 Streamlined Processes: IT support can help healthcare organizations to streamline their processes and reduce administrative burdens For example, electronic health records (EHR) systems can automate many tasks, such as scheduling appointments and sending prescription orders This not only saves time for healthcare providers, but also improves the overall patient experience by reducing wait times and paperwork.

3 Data Security: Protecting patient data is essential in healthcare, as sensitive information is often stored in electronic systems IT support helps healthcare organizations to implement security measures to prevent data breaches and ensure that patient information remains confidential By providing regular updates and monitoring systems for any suspicious activities, IT support can help healthcare providers to maintain the trust of patients and comply with privacy regulations.

Remote Support: With the rise of telemedicine and remote patient monitoring, IT support has become even more critical for healthcare organizations IT professionals can provide remote support to healthcare providers, ensuring that their systems are running smoothly and securely This allows healthcare providers to focus on delivering care to patients, rather than worrying about technical issues.

5 Compliance: Healthcare organizations are subject to stringent regulations, such as the Health Insurance Portability and Accountability Act (HIPAA), which govern the protection of patient data IT support can help healthcare organizations to ensure compliance with these regulations by providing secure systems and protocols for managing patient information By keeping up to date with the latest security measures and industry standards, IT support can help healthcare providers to avoid costly fines and legal issues.

6 Disaster Recovery: In the event of a data breach or system failure, IT support plays a crucial role in disaster recovery By implementing backup systems and recovery plans, IT professionals can help healthcare organizations to quickly restore data and services, minimizing downtime and ensuring continuity of care for patients Having a robust disaster recovery plan in place is essential for healthcare organizations to protect patient information and maintain trust with patients.

In conclusion, IT support is essential for healthcare organizations to deliver high-quality care to patients, streamline processes, ensure data security, and comply with regulations By investing in IT support, healthcare providers can improve patient outcomes, enhance efficiency, and maintain the trust of their patients As technology continues to advance, IT support will play an increasingly important role in the healthcare industry, helping healthcare organizations to stay ahead of the curve and deliver the best possible care to patients.
